About

The residential neighbourhood of Cheadle Hulme centres around the open parkland of Orrishmere. This area is primarily composed of semi-detached and detached housing, with local shopping parades providing everyday amenities. The layout is defined by quiet, tree-lined streets that branch from the main roads, creating a settled suburban environment.

The focal point is Orrishmere itself, a large park with a popular bowling green and a well-used playground. A distinctive feature is the park's original Edwardian bandstand, which hosts community events. The area is served by Cheadle Hulme railway station, providing direct links to Manchester city centre and the wider rail network.

Area overview

On average Cheadle Hulme Orrishmere has very low de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 54 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 4.1%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Cheadle Hulme Orrishmere is £57,510 per year. There are 6 schools in Cheadle Hulme Orrishmere: 2 primary (0 Outstanding and 2 Good) and 1 secondary (1 Outstanding and 0 Good). Cheadle Hulme Orrishmere is home to around 7,841 people, with a population density of about 3,062.1 per km2.

Property prices in Cheadle Hulme Orrishmere

Based on 107 recent sales, the median property price is £400,000 in Cheadle Hulme Orrishmere area, with individual transactions ranging from £90,000 up to £1,270,000.
